March of Dimes, the leading nonprofit organization for pregnancy and baby health, is seeking a highly energetic Email Marketing Coordinator to develop, optimize and execute successful email marketing initiatives. This is a temporary position (February – May) that will work on apart-time basis (estimated 30 hours a week) to assist with registration, fundraising, and retention efforts to support over 300 March for Babies events. The Email Marketing Coordinator will report directly to the Email Marketing Manager.

The successful candidate will be a self-starter who demonstrates a high degree of proactivity, works well in a collaborative environment, and is comfortable with HTML/CSS.

Areas of Responsibility: 
  • Manage the end-to-end execution of daily email deployments including intake management, coding, approvals, quality assurance, testing, scheduling, and analysis
  • Work with internal March of Dimes staff including local market, CRM, direct response, creative, marketing and brand teams to meet campaign objectives and timelines
  • Assist in keeping email calendar up to date, coordinating with the Email Marketing Manager to ensure local initiatives and national campaigns are strategically timed for maximize impact
  • Provide insights and recommendations based on email performance reports and best practices
  • Support HTML email template development and troubleshooting as needed
  • Support other operations needs including list processing, data matching, and CRM import requests as needed.

Mission: 

With the success of the Salk vaccine in the mid 1950s, the March of Dimes turned its focus on birth defects, low birth weight and infant death. Over the past 75 years, March of Dimes' cutting edge research and innovative programs have saved millions of babies from death or disability.
